A hydroponic nutrient film technique (NFT) system is a soilless cultivation method in which a thin stream of nutrient-rich water continuously flows over plant roots, delivering essential minerals and oxygen. The system uses channels or troughs to recirculate the solution, promoting efficient nutrient absorption and accelerated plant growth. A hydroponic nutrient film technique improves water and fertilizer usage while supporting high-density cultivation in controlled settings.
The essential product types of hydroponic nutrient film technique (NFT) systems include commercial, residential, and modular NFT systems. Commercial NFT systems are designed for large-scale, professional indoor farming, offering automated nutrient delivery, optimized plant growth, and high operational efficiency. They are used for leafy greens, herbs, fruits and vegetables, and flowers, constructed from polyvinyl chloride-based channels, stainless steel channels, aluminum channels, and plastic reservoirs. Distribution is through direct sales (OEM), retail and specialty stores, and online or e-commerce channels, applied in indoor farming, greenhouses, and research and educational institutes.
Tariffs have affected the hydroponic NFT systems market by increasing the cost of imported components such as channels, pumps, and sensors, particularly impacting commercial and modular systems in regions like North America, Europe, and Asia-Pacific. Residential systems are moderately affected due to local manufacturing options. While tariffs have raised production costs and slowed expansion in some segments, they have also incentivized local manufacturing and innovation in cost-efficient, modular NFT systems, enabling manufacturers to optimize supply chains and reduce dependency on imports.

The hydroponic nutrient film technique (NFT) system market size has grown rapidly in recent years. It will grow from $2.49 billion in 2025 to $2.84 billion in 2026 at a compound annual growth rate (CAGR) of 14.2%. The growth in the historic period can be attributed to increasing demand for year-round crop production, rise of controlled environment agriculture, adoption of hydroponic methods in commercial farming, expansion of leafy greens and herb cultivation, government support for sustainable agriculture.
The hydroponic nutrient film technique (NFT) system market size is expected to see rapid growth in the next few years. It will grow to $4.88 billion by 2030 at a compound annual growth rate (CAGR) of 14.5%. The growth in the forecast period can be attributed to growth of urban farming projects, increasing integration of smart farming technologies, rising investment in vertical farming systems, demand for modular and scalable hydroponic solutions, focus on climate-resilient and resource-efficient agriculture. Major trends in the forecast period include rising adoption of hydroponic nutrient film technique systems, increasing demand for high-density controlled environment farming, growth in urban and vertical farming initiatives, enhanced water and fertilizer use efficiency practices, expansion of research and educational applications in hydroponics.
The growing emphasis on sustainable agricultural practices is anticipated to drive the expansion of the hydroponic nutrient film technique (NFT) system market in the coming years. Sustainable agricultural practices refer to farming methods designed to produce food efficiently while conserving natural resources, minimizing environmental impact, and ensuring the long-term sustainability of food production systems. The heightened focus on sustainable agriculture is primarily fueled by the increasing scarcity of arable land and freshwater resources, as traditional farming methods continue to degrade soil health and consume large amounts of water. The rising emphasis on sustainable agriculture directly increases demand for NFT systems, as these soilless growing solutions use up to 90% less water than conventional farming, deliver nutrients directly to plant roots, and optimize crop yield within limited space, making them an effective solution for resource-efficient food production. For example, in May 2025, according to GOV.UK, a UK-based government website, the UK had 503 thousand hectares of organically farmed land in 2024, reflecting a 1.0% increase from 2023. Therefore, the growing emphasis on sustainable agricultural practices is propelling the expansion of the hydroponic nutrient film technique (NFT) system market.

Leading companies operating in the hydroponic NFT system market are focusing on forming strategic partnerships to expand distribution networks and strengthen their presence in controlled environment agriculture markets. Strategic partnerships are cooperative arrangements where organizations combine resources and expertise to achieve shared objectives, enhance innovation, and extend market reach without merging ownership. For example, in February 2026, Dalsem B.V., a Netherlands-based greenhouse engineering company, collaborated with Harvest Singularity, Inc., a US-based agritech company specializing in advanced hydroponic and controlled-environment farming solutions, to develop a 3-hectare high-tech lettuce greenhouse in Newberry. The facility is designed for the region's warm and humid climate and features Dalsem Air Technology 2.0, advanced cooling systems, LED lighting, and a mobile NFT gutter system to enable year-round, pesticide-free production for the U.S. market.
